
There are many choices when it comes down to computer and information science careers. A computer programmer may create new apps for mobile technology or help design a new type of computer system. You might also find them developing new languages and operating platforms to make it easier for people to communicate and use technology effectively. These careers give individuals the opportunity to use their coding skills on a variety tasks and help shape future technology.
Computer programmer
Computer programming jobs are great for people who have strong math and logic skills. You can work at home and not rent an office. Additionally, you can become self-employed. There are many different fields you can work in, and you can progress in your career at any stage. Although computer programmers' prospects are dimming, there are still great opportunities.
According to the United States Department of Labor Bureau of Labor Statistics, computer programmers have still plenty of growth potential. These positions will be highly compensated and evolve with technology. Software developers need to be proficient in programming and have knowledge of different coding languages.

Database administrator
Database administrators play an important role in almost any company. Their duties include organizing data and monitoring ongoing maintenance. They should also be patient with others and work as part of a team. They must also be responsible for protecting sensitive company data. They should also know how to test programs for potential vulnerabilities.
A bachelor's degree is required to work in database administration. Even though this path is most difficult and costly, it can be done in as little as two years. Most universities also offer transferable credits. Some schools also offer online degree programs that can be completed at your own pace.
Web developer
A Web developer's role is to create and maintain websites. They use tools such version control to keep track and spot any errors. They can optimize site elements to increase scalability and integrate externally. A web developer typically works in a team with other professionals in web design and software development. Apart from their technical expertise in programming, Web developers are well-known for their client-centric and collaborative approach.
A typical Web developer resume should include links and screenshots of websites they've built in the past. You can also describe the coding used. Apart from the online portfolio, a web designer's resume should highlight work experience and education.

Software engineer
Anyone interested in coding can choose a career as a software engineer. Flexible working hours and a good salary are some of the benefits of this profession. You can choose to work from your home or for an international company. You will be responsible for meeting deadlines and delivering projects on time. This job is rewarding but also challenging.
As a software engineer, you'll write code, create frameworks, and execute builds. You will solve business problems for millions. You might even be able to develop your own software. You will communicate with clients and colleagues via email.
FAQ
Do I hire a web developer or make it myself?
If you want to save cash, don't pay for web designer services. If you need high quality results, it may not be worthwhile to hire someone else to build your website.
There are many ways to create websites from scratch, without having to hire expensive designers.
If you're willing and able to invest the time and effort to create a stunning website, you can use free tools such as Dreamweaver or Photoshop to learn how to do it yourself.
Consider outsourcing your project to an experienced freelancer web developer who charges hourly instead of per-project.
Is WordPress a CMS?
The answer is yes. It's a Content Management System. CMS is a way to manage your website content without having to use an application such Dreamweaver/Frontpage.
WordPress's best feature is its free pricing! Hosting is all you need, and it's usually free.
WordPress was originally created to be a blogging platform. But WordPress now offers many more options, such as eCommerce sites or forums, membership websites and portfolios.
WordPress is easy to install and set up. You must download the installation file from their website and upload it onto your server. You can then visit your domain name using your web browser to log in to your new website.
After installing WordPress, you'll need to register for a username and password. Once you log in, you will be able to access your settings from a dashboard.
You can now add pages, posts and images to your site. If editing and creating new content is easier for you, skip this step.
You can also hire a professional web design firm to help you with the whole process.
Can I create my own website with HTML & CSS?
Yes! If you've been following along so far, you should now understand how to start creating a website.
You're now familiar with the basics of creating a website structure. However, you must also learn HTML and CSS Coding.
HTML stands for HyperText Markup Language. It's like creating a recipe for a dish. It would include ingredients, instructions, as well as directions. HTML is a way to tell a computer which parts are bold, underlined, italicized or linked to other parts of the document. It's the language that documents use.
CSS stands to represent Cascading Stylesheets. Think of it like a style sheet for recipes. Instead of listing each ingredient and instructing, you can write down general guidelines for font sizes, colors and spacing.
HTML tells a browser how to format a webpage; CSS tells a browser how to do it.
Don't panic if either of these terms are confusing to you. Follow the tutorials below, and you'll soon be making beautiful websites.
Where can I locate freelance web developers
There are many places you can find freelance web designers or developers. These are the top options:
Freelance sites
These sites offer job listings for freelance professionals. Some sites require specific skills, while others may not care about the type of work that you do.
Elance is a great place to find graphic designers, programmers and translators.
oDesk also offers similar features, but focuses more on software development. They offer positions in PHP and Java, JavaScripts, Ruby, C++, Python, JavaScripts, Ruby, iOS, Android, as well as.NET developers.
Another option is oWOW. Their site focuses primarily on web designers and graphic design. You can also get video editing, programming and SEO services.
Forums Online
Many forums allow members to post jobs and advertise themselves. DeviantArt is a forum for web developers. A list of threads will appear if you type "web developer” in the search box.
Statistics
- Is your web design optimized for mobile? Over 50% of internet users browse websites using a mobile device. (wix.com)
- At this point, it's important to note that just because a web trend is current, it doesn't mean it's necessarily right for you.48% of people cite design as the most important factor of a website, (websitebuilderexpert.com)
- Studies show that 77% of satisfied customers will recommend your business or service to a friend after having a positive experience. (wix.com)
- It's estimated that in 2022, over 2.14 billion people will purchase goods and services online. (wix.com)
- When choosing your website color scheme, a general rule is to limit yourself to three shades: one primary color (60% of the mix), one secondary color (30%), and one accent color (10%). (wix.com)
External Links
How To
How to become a web developer?
A website does not simply contain HTML code. It's an interactive platform that lets you communicate with users, and offer valuable content.
Websites can be more than just a means of delivering information. It should also serve as a portal to your company. It should be easy for customers to find the information they need quickly, and it should also allow them to interact with your company in a way that is convenient.
The best websites allow visitors to do exactly what they came to do--find what they're looking for and then leave.
This goal will require you to master technical skills and aesthetics. You'll need to learn HTML5 coding and CSS3 styling as well as the latest developments in JavaScript.
Also, you'll need to learn how to use tools like Photoshop, Illustrator, InDesign and Fireworks. This allows designers to create and edit web graphics and layouts. And finally, you'll need to develop your style guide, which includes everything from fonts to colors to layout.
To learn more about becoming a web designer, you can start by reading articles or taking online courses.
Although your degree may take months, or even years, once you earn it you will be ready for the workforce.
Practice makes perfect! Your ability to design will make it easier for you build amazing websites.